Analysis

The most recent figure for inflation, consumer prices in Early-demographic dividend is 3.2%, measured in 2025.

That represents a change of down 2.6% on the previous year and up 2.4% over ten years.

Over the whole period, inflation, consumer prices in Early-demographic dividend peaked at 19.1% in 1974 and was at its lowest, 2.0%, in 1967.

Early-demographic dividend ranks 21st of 45 groups on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Inflation, consumer prices in Early-demographic dividend, year by year

Annual values for Inflation, consumer prices (annual %) in Early-demographic dividend, 1966 to 2025.
Year annual % Change
1966 4.5%
1967 2.0% -55.9%
1968 2.1% +5.1%
1969 3.0% +43.1%
1970 3.8% +28.2%
1971 4.2% +10.0%
1972 6.1% +44.8%
1973 12.1% +98.9%
1974 19.1% +57.8%
1975 12.9% -32.5%
1976 10.1% -21.4%
1977 12.2% +20.1%
1978 9.3% -23.4%
1979 11.5% +23.9%
1980 14.7% +27.2%
1981 12.4% -15.5%
1982 10.2% -17.7%
1983 10.2% +0.2%
1984 8.5% -17.0%
1985 9.4% +10.1%
1986 10.4% +11.6%
1987 9.8% -6.6%
1988 9.0% -7.9%
1989 9.1% +1.0%
1990 11.9% +31.2%
1991 15.1% +26.4%
1992 10.5% -30.1%
1993 10.0% -5.3%
1994 9.6% -3.8%
1995 10.0% +4.5%
1996 8.5% -15.0%
1997 7.0% -17.6%
1998 6.4% -8.5%
1999 5.0% -21.8%
2000 3.9% -22.4%
2001 3.8% -3.8%
2002 4.2% +13.0%
2003 5.5% +28.6%
2004 4.4% -18.7%
2005 4.8% +8.7%
2006 5.7% +17.9%
2007 6.2% +8.6%
2008 10.4% +69.1%
2009 4.4% -58.1%
2010 4.4% +0.5%
2011 5.8% +32.2%
2012 5.0% -13.6%
2013 4.8% -3.8%
2014 4.1% -15.6%
2015 3.1% -23.2%
2016 3.5% +12.6%
2017 3.3% -5.5%
2018 4.0% +19.5%
2019 2.8% -30.5%
2020 3.0% +7.3%
2021 4.1% +39.3%
2022 7.2% +74.4%
2023 5.9% -18.2%
2024 3.3% -44.1%
2025 3.2% -2.6%

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s 2.9% 2.0% 4.5% 4
1970s 10.1% 3.8% 19.1% 10
1980s 10.4% 8.5% 14.7% 10
1990s 9.4% 5.0% 15.1% 10
2000s 5.3% 3.8% 10.4% 10
2010s 4.1% 2.8% 5.8% 10
2020s 4.4% 3.0% 7.2% 6

Inflation as measured by the consumer price index reflects the annual percentage change in the cost to the average consumer of acquiring a basket of goods and services that may be fixed or changed at specified intervals, such as yearly.
